I made a chain necklace in blender (duplicated toruses) i go to test grid to check it out, press the calculate cost and equiv button and 10 minutes later im still calculating.  I went back into blender and joined each link to one another by at least 1 vert and tried again still calculating...   I thought ok maybe it's just really big for some reason so I compared the face count with another mesh I made around the same count about 9k triangles this mesh uploads in 2 seconds or less.  Can anyone tell me what to do here?

I am seeing this too. There is a 65536 vertex limit. Before you say "but I don't have that many vertices"...that's actually why I have come to the forum today!

If I try to upload a mesh with 11001 vertices (according to Blender 2.49b), the "Calculate..." button DOES return a result, but the Mesh Upload window shows my mesh has 65383 vertices. If I try adding a few more vertices in Blender and retrying the same steps, the "Calculate..." button never returns with anything, no error, nothing.

I don't know why 11001 = 65383. But I bet that's what you're running into too.

Hmm. I made a thing with 88 toruses (12x4 verts) interlinked. Actually I made two and duplicated 22x with array modifier, then added mirror modifier to get 88 in two chains of 44. I used the upload dialog with as many different settings as I could think of for physics shape and with and without scaling down to necklace size. I did not come across any problem with calculation delays. This was without UV map. I will add that and try again.

PS. It's ok with a UV map too.

I guess the next question is which viewer and server you are using. These tests were on (Help About)...

Viewer: Second Life 3.0.3 (240895) Sep 15 2011 11:47:07 (Second Life Release)
Server: DRTSIM-85 11.09.15.240906 (Mesh Sandbox 25 located at sim9001.aditi.lindenlab.com)

You should probably not be using an earlier viewer.

Note though, that the cost calculation is done by the server.

I'm not using the current Project Mesh development viewer because it invariably crashes within 30 seconds of landing in a mesh sandbox!

 PPS. The triangle count you give is slightly higher than the 2x12x4x86 (=8256) for the toruses. Is there something else there? Is it supposed to be there?
